Constraint and Innovation

Do to a complicated vacuuming accident my fellow blogger and drummer Sheldon can't use his right arm for awhile. 

Obviously there is the one armed drummer from Def Leppard .. but deeper than his personal victory is the principle that made Twitter virtually explode on to the scene.

When restrictive parameters are laid out with absolute clarity the conditions are ripe for wild experimental creativity and growth.

Limits are opportunities to test drive and/or implement new perspectives.

Take the book STICK CONTROL: do 8th notes with the hi-hat using only the foot. R=Kick. L=Snare. 

Open and expand through times of constraint rather than contracting into victimhood.
